6 hurt as four bombs explode in Sirajganj

By Our Correspondent, Sirajganj
8 July 2006, 18:00 PM
At least six people pedestrians were injured when four bombs exploded at SS Road in Sirajganj town Friday night.

Police later recovered three more bombs from the spot and took those to Sadar police station.

Police and local people said the four bombs, kept by some unidentified miscreants on the road, went off when a rickshaw wheel pressed those.

The injured, were treated at local clinics.

The incident created panic among the townspeople. Police have been deployed in prime spots in the town.

Police recorded a case but could neither arrest any body not find any clue to the incident.
